Pelahatchie is 9-1 against Puckett since January of 2019 and they'll have a chance to extend that success on Thursday. The Pelahatchie Chiefs will host the Puckett Wolves at 5:30 p.m. Pelahatchie knows how to get points on the board -- the team has finished with 55 points or more in their past nine matchups -- so hopefully Puckett likes a good challenge.
Last Friday, Pelahatchie blew past Pisgah, posting a 64-17 win. The Chiefs have made a habit of sweeping their opponents off the court, having now won 12 contests by 21 points or more this season.
Meanwhile, Puckett strolled past Pisgah with points to spare on Tuesday, taking the game 53-39. The victory made it back-to-back wins for the Wolves.
Pelahatchie has also been performing incredibly well recently as they've won 12 of their last 13 games, which provided a nice bump to their 23-2 record this season. The wins came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 64.3 points per game. As for Puckett, they pushed their record up to 11-13 with the victory, which was their third straight at home.
Everything came up roses for Pelahatchie against Puckett in their previous meeting two weeks ago, as the squad secured a 75-34 win. Does Pelahatchie have another victory up their sleeve, or will Puckett tur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
